| /// Checks the dependency at the given path. Changes `bad` to `true` if a check failed. |
| /// |
| /// Specifically, this checks that the license is correct. |
| pub fn check(path: &Path, bad: &mut bool) { |
| // Check licences |
| let path = path.join("vendor"); |
| assert!(path.exists(), "vendor directory missing"); |
| let mut saw_dir = false; |
| for dir in t!(path.read_dir()) { |
| saw_dir = true; |
| let dir = t!(dir); |
| |
| // skip our exceptions |
| if EXCEPTIONS.iter().any(|exception| { |
| dir.path() |
| .to_str() |
| .unwrap() |
| .contains(&format!("src/vendor/{}", exception)) |
| }) { |
| continue; |
| } |
| |
| let toml = dir.path().join("Cargo.toml"); |
| *bad = *bad || !check_license(&toml); |
| } |
| assert!(saw_dir, "no vendored source"); |
| } |

| /// Checks the dependency of WHITELIST_CRATES at the given path. Changes `bad` to `true` if a check |
| /// failed. |
| /// |
| /// Specifically, this checks that the dependencies are on the WHITELIST. |
| pub fn check_whitelist(path: &Path, cargo: &Path, bad: &mut bool) { |
| // Get dependencies from cargo metadata |
| let resolve = get_deps(path, cargo); |
| |
| // Get the whitelist into a convenient form |
| let whitelist: HashSet<_> = WHITELIST.iter().cloned().collect(); |
| |
| // Check dependencies |
| let mut visited = BTreeSet::new(); |
| let mut unapproved = BTreeSet::new(); |
| for &krate in WHITELIST_CRATES.iter() { |
| let mut bad = check_crate_whitelist(&whitelist, &resolve, &mut visited, krate, false); |
| unapproved.append(&mut bad); |
| } |
| |
| if unapproved.len() > 0 { |
| println!("Dependencies not on the whitelist:"); |
| for dep in unapproved { |
| println!("* {}", dep.id_str()); |
| } |
| *bad = true; |
| } |
| |
| check_crate_duplicate(&resolve, bad); |
| } |

| fn check_license(path: &Path) -> bool { |
| if !path.exists() { |
| panic!("{} does not exist", path.display()); |
| } |
| let mut contents = String::new(); |
| t!(t!(File::open(path)).read_to_string(&mut contents)); |
| |
| let mut found_license = false; |
| for line in contents.lines() { |
| if !line.starts_with("license") { |
| continue; |
| } |
| let license = extract_license(line); |
| if !LICENSES.contains(&&*license) { |
| println!("invalid license {} in {}", license, path.display()); |
| return false; |
| } |
| found_license = true; |
| break; |
| } |
| if !found_license { |
| println!("no license in {}", path.display()); |
| return false; |
| } |
| |
| true |
| } |
| |
| fn extract_license(line: &str) -> String { |
| let first_quote = line.find('"'); |
| let last_quote = line.rfind('"'); |
| if let (Some(f), Some(l)) = (first_quote, last_quote) { |
| let license = &line[f + 1..l]; |
| license.into() |
| } else { |
| "bad-license-parse".into() |
| } |
| } |

| /// Get the dependencies of the crate at the given path using `cargo metadata`. |
| fn get_deps(path: &Path, cargo: &Path) -> Resolve { |
| // Run `cargo metadata` to get the set of dependencies |
| let output = Command::new(cargo) |
| .arg("metadata") |
| .arg("--format-version") |
| .arg("1") |
| .arg("--manifest-path") |
| .arg(path.join("Cargo.toml")) |
| .output() |
| .expect("Unable to run `cargo metadata`") |
| .stdout; |
| let output = String::from_utf8_lossy(&output); |
| let output: Output = serde_json::from_str(&output).unwrap(); |
| |
| output.resolve |
| } |
| |
| /// Checks the dependencies of the given crate from the given cargo metadata to see if they are on |
| /// the whitelist. Returns a list of illegal dependencies. |
| fn check_crate_whitelist<'a, 'b>( |
| whitelist: &'a HashSet<Crate>, |
| resolve: &'a Resolve, |
| visited: &'b mut BTreeSet<CrateVersion<'a>>, |
| krate: CrateVersion<'a>, |
| must_be_on_whitelist: bool, |
| ) -> BTreeSet<Crate<'a>> { |
| // Will contain bad deps |
| let mut unapproved = BTreeSet::new(); |
| |
| // Check if we have already visited this crate |
| if visited.contains(&krate) { |
| return unapproved; |
| } |
| |
| visited.insert(krate); |
| |
| // If this path is in-tree, we don't require it to be on the whitelist |
| if must_be_on_whitelist { |
| // If this dependency is not on the WHITELIST, add to bad set |
| if !whitelist.contains(&krate.into()) { |
| unapproved.insert(krate.into()); |
| } |
| } |
| |
| // Do a DFS in the crate graph (it's a DAG, so we know we have no cycles!) |
| let to_check = resolve |
| .nodes |
| .iter() |
| .find(|n| n.id.starts_with(&krate.id_str())) |
| .expect("crate does not exist"); |
| |
| for dep in to_check.dependencies.iter() { |
| let (krate, is_path_dep) = CrateVersion::from_str(dep); |
| |
| let mut bad = check_crate_whitelist(whitelist, resolve, visited, krate, !is_path_dep); |
| unapproved.append(&mut bad); |
| } |
| |
| unapproved |
| } |
